Colonial Life disability insurance can provide short-term income protection when you're unable to work. Learn more about how disability insurance works, ...

Employers typically offer two kinds of disability plans: short-term and long-term. Short-term disability pays out after only a few weeks, while long-term policies tend to cover up to age 65, depending on the plan design chosen by the employer. Many employers require employees to pay a portion of their premiums through payroll deductions.I think long-term disability is valuable. It is harder to self-insure against than short-term disability, but it is also less likely to happen, which makes it a more appropriate risk to insure against with insurance. When you visit and site, Dotdash Meredith and its associates may storage oder retrieve information on owner online, mostly inbound the application of cookies.Aug 18, 2023 · Disability insurance usually costs between 1% and 3% of your annual pre-tax salary. So, for every $100,000 you make, you can expect to pay between $1,000 and $3,000 a year. But what you pay for disability insurance also depends on a lot of personal factors, like how old you are, where you live, your gender, your medical history, and your job. oil refinery stockssocially conscious investing mutual funds In recent years, short-term rentals have become increasingly popular among travelers and renters alike.
